November 6, 2013 - The Fort Wayne Fire Department responded to a reported modular home fully engulfed in fire in the 2700 block of W. Washington Rd. Upon arrival at lot #219, firefighters found a single wide home fully involved with fire exposure to the neighboring home. Firefighters were able to contain the blaze to lot 219, but the fire house was a total loss. Seven people were home at the time of the blaze but were able to self-evacuate and were being assisted by the Red Cross. One occupant did suffer burns to their arm and was transported to a local hospital. As many as five family pets may have perished. FWPD, TRAA and AEP assisted at the scene. The cause of the blaze remains under investigation.
